Jack-O-Lantern Spectacular
I just got home from the Jack-O-Lantern Spectacular, an annual event that takes place at Providence's Roger Williams Park Zoo. It was amazing, to say the least. There are over 5,000 hand-carved pumpkins scattered throughout a trail with themes and music playing throughout. This is the third year in a row that I've gone and it seems to get better each year!
One of my favorites this year was this beautiful dragon that represented the Chinese New Year as part of the "Around the World" section of the show. First of all, it was huge and so detailed. I feel like the picture doesn't even look like a real pumpkin! It was a fun way to get into the Halloween spirit and now I can't wait to carve a pumpkin this weekend. Wonders of WaterFire
One of the best parts about summers in Providence (in my opinion) is WaterFire. It's a unique, free event that takes place in Waterplace park with lots of local food vendors and live entertainment. We walked around for a while tonight, and my favorite part by far was the park decorated with illuminated blue stars. They were so magical and looked like they were suspended in midair.
